Output 3eba8f656fc8b64c809122439efb1a6c19af259a4dcffb5fa094da0e2775f0ab:0

value
5000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d5f891cce5f2d0f051975865a0246f4cb4fe929e7bd9f01d503d0492015313dc
address
bc1p6hufrn897tg0q5vhtpj6qfr0fj60ay5700vlq82s85zfyq2nz0wq3l9hq8
transaction
3eba8f656fc8b64c809122439efb1a6c19af259a4dcffb5fa094da0e2775f0ab
confirmations
99620
spent
true